# AingDesk vs openless

*GraphCanon updated Aug 14, 2026*

## Verdict

Pick AingDesk if aingDesk is a beginner-friendly AI assistant that provides features like local model deployment, knowledge base integration, and online sharing capabilities; pick openless if openless is a Rust-based open-source tool that offers AI-polished text output from voice input for users on macOS and Windows platforms.

[AingDesk](https://www.aingdesk.com) reports 2.5k GitHub stars, 287 forks, and 71 open issues, last pushed Jun 4, 2026. [openless](https://github.com/appergb/openless) has 2.9k stars, 252 forks, and 34 open issues, last pushed Jul 22, 2026. Figures are from public GitHub metadata via [AingDesk's repository](https://github.com/aingdesk/AingDesk) and [openless's repository](https://github.com/Open-Less/openless).

## When NOT to use AingDesk

- - Avoid using it if advanced customizations or a higher level of flexibility in setup is required since its features are aimed at simple use cases.
- - If server-side deployment needs to be handled without Docker, as its documentation primarily revolves around this container technology which might not suit users unfamiliar with Docker.

## When NOT to use openless

- You require extensive customization options for AI text polishing, as Openless offers limited user-tuning settings compared to some competitors.
- Your operating system is Linux; while it's listed under topics, the tool is explicitly developed and supported for macOS and Windows only.
